The SMBG5344BE3/TR13 belongs to the category of semiconductor devices.
This product is used for voltage regulation and transient voltage suppression in electronic circuits.
The SMBG5344BE3/TR13 comes in a surface mount package.
The essence of this product lies in its ability to protect sensitive electronic components from voltage spikes and transients.
The SMBG5344BE3/TR13 is typically packaged in reels and is available in varying quantities depending on the supplier.
The SMBG5344BE3/TR13 has two pins, with the anode connected to pin 1 and the cathode connected to pin 2.
The SMBG5344BE3/TR13 works by diverting excess voltage away from sensitive components, thereby protecting them from damage due to voltage spikes and transients. When the voltage exceeds the breakdown voltage, the device conducts, shunting the excess current to ground.
The SMBG5344BE3/TR13 is commonly used in: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ems
